dbader / potatoes
A small computer operating system for x86 instruction set architectures written in ANSI C and assembly language.
☆20Updated 11 years ago
Related projects ⓘ
Alternatives and complementary repositories for potatoes
- MikeOS' BASIC Compiler☆22Updated 2 years ago
- Writing a 16 bit (8086-like) operating system...☆16Updated 3 years ago
- Register Allocator for 8086☆75Updated last year
- A small, embeddable BASIC interpreter in C.☆21Updated 6 years ago
- VulpineSystem - RISC-V fantasy computer☆17Updated last year
- This repository contains OS development specific code and tutorials☆10Updated 3 months ago
- x86 assembler in 512 bytes of x86 machine code☆32Updated 4 years ago
- Simple OS kernel with BASIC interpreter for x86☆44Updated last year
- PDP-11 emulation☆54Updated 3 months ago
- The xv6 operating system, ported to the Raspberry Pi☆11Updated 5 years ago
- A minimalistic library to help making your x86 assembly program bootable.☆25Updated 5 years ago
- A pure Python 16 bits CPU emulator☆42Updated 4 years ago
- Custom 64-bit pipelined RISC processor☆13Updated 3 months ago
- Non-unix, custom-API hybrid OS kernel written in C++ which can be thought of as an emulated microkernel. The native API is almost fully a…☆16Updated last year
- uckermit: μC‑Kermit (μCKermit, micro‑C‑Kermit, microkermit) is a minimalistic Kermit implementation for small, embedded, or resource cons…☆16Updated 11 months ago
- B language compiler☆29Updated 4 years ago
- Running COBOL on the wild!? No OS required, works with multiboot☆10Updated last year
- fork of PCE focusing on macplus, supporting DaynaPort SCSI network emulation☆10Updated last year
- 🎨 An ansi escape code parser and renderer for hobby operating systems☆44Updated 3 years ago
- Intel IA16 emulator for embedded development☆38Updated 11 months ago
- Multi-architecture hobby operating system created in C☆16Updated last year
- a small (~140 line) and portable 6502 emulator demo.☆16Updated 2 years ago
- Lightweight 8086 simulator for running ELKS and DOS programs☆16Updated last year
- Software and documentation, mostly from the 80s and 90s☆20Updated 9 years ago
- Final Year Project - Multi-Tasking GUI based Operating System designed with usability in mind☆13Updated 6 years ago
- OTCC Deobfuscated and Explained☆30Updated last year
- Retro UNIX v1 (8086 port/derivation of Original UNIX v1 for PDP-11) and Retro UNIX 386 v1.? OS project☆16Updated 3 weeks ago
- Bootable PC demo/game kernel☆49Updated 2 years ago